From her 1979 LP 'The Glow' comes a cover of the Isaac Hayes/David Porter composition 'I thank you' first recorded by Sam and Dave a decade before. ZZ Top also charted with the track the same year Bonnie recorded it. I prefer Ms Raitt's version to all the others. John Farnham and Tom Jones have also memorialised the song in more recent years. 'The Glow' was a solid outing for Bonnie at the end of a decade that saw her record 7 albums and establish herself as a kick ass musician, but not yet as a pop icon. That would still take another decade, but for me the 1982 LP 'Green Light' and its follow up 'Nine Lives' would have me a dedicated follower for life. That voice, so textured so compelling as well as that guitar brilliance. The only song to cause any stirring on the charts from this '79 set was 'You gonna get what's coming' in early 1980.
